I've said it before, but while at UConn Aaron Hill has always hit well in the summer collegiate leagues, and Penders in preseason interviews has had terrific things to say about how he plays in fall ball. Then the regular college season starts and the last two years Hill starts the season in big slumps. Hopefully his hitting is finally getting turned around to how he can really perform.
